Job Purpose

The Accountant will support sound financial decision-making by accurately recording, reconciling and reporting financial transactions. The role also involves maintaining compliance with Tanzanian statutory requirements, accounting standards and internal control procedures.

Key Responsibilities

Accounts and Financial Operations

The Accountant will:

  • Manage accounts payable and accounts receivable.
  • Conduct supplier and customer reconciliations.
  • Process supplier payments.
  • Process staff reimbursements, imprest and expense claims.
  • Prepare and issue customer sales invoices.
  • Allocate customer receipts.
  • Follow up on outstanding receivables.
  • Prepare customer statements and aging reports.

Banking, Cash and Petty Cash

Responsibilities will include:

  • Performing daily and monthly bank reconciliations.
  • Reconciling mobile money and electronic payments.
  • Managing petty cash imprest and retirements.
  • Ensuring cash transactions are accurately recorded and supported.

Taxation and Statutory Compliance

The Accountant will support compliance with Tanzanian tax requirements by:

  • Preparing and supporting VAT, PAYE and withholding tax filings.
  • Maintaining tax schedules and reconciliations.
  • Supporting Tanzania Revenue Authority (TRA) audits.
  • Assisting with statutory correspondence and related tax matters.

Reconciliations and Financial Reporting

The successful candidate will:

  • Maintain accurate general ledger balances.
  • Prepare supplier, customer and intercompany reconciliations.
  • Support month-end closing activities.
  • Support year-end closing processes.
  • Assist in preparing management accounts.
  • Investigate and resolve financial discrepancies.

Audit, Compliance and Internal Controls

Duties will also include:

  • Supporting internal and external audits.
  • Preparing audit schedules and supporting documentation.
  • Ensuring compliance with internal controls and company policies.
  • Maintaining accurate financial records for audit and reporting purposes.

Stock and Store Management

The Accountant will also support inventory management by:

  • Maintaining accurate inventory records.
  • Overseeing stock movements and reconciliations.
  • Investigating stock variances.
  • Supporting stock audits.

Academic and Professional Requirements

Applicants should have:

  • A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ance or a related field.
  • CPA Level II as a minimum qualification.
  • CPA Level III is preferred.
  • 2–4 years of progressive accounting experience.
  • Strong knowledge of Microsoft Excel.
  • Experience with accounting systems.

Skills and Competencies

The ideal candidate should demonstrate:

  • High attention to detail.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ills.
  • High levels of integrity and professionalism.
  • Ability to work independently.
  • Ability to meet deadlines and manage competing priorities.
  • Strong teamwork and collaboration skills.
